A metal bracket for a 4×4 post is an essential component for securing and reinforcing wooden posts in various construction projects. These brackets provide stability, strength, and long-term durability, making them ideal for fences, decks, pergolas, and other structural frameworks. Made from heavy-duty materials like galvanized steel or stainless steel, they resist rust, corrosion, and weather damage. Choosing the right metal bracket ensures a secure and long-lasting connection, preventing wobbling or structural failure. Whether for DIY projects or professional construction, a well-designed metal bracket enhances safety and support for 4×4 posts.

Types of Metal Brackets for 4×4 Post

Metal brackets for 4×4 posts come in different types, each designed for specific applications. These brackets provide stability and durability, making them essential for construction and woodworking projects. Below are the main types:

  • Corner Brackets
    • Corner brackets are L-shaped and provide strong support at the joint where two wood pieces meet. They are commonly used for fences, pergolas, and deck framing.
  • Post Base Brackets
    • These brackets secure a 4×4 post to concrete or wooden surfaces. They prevent moisture damage and increase the stability of the structure.
  • T-Brackets
    • T-brackets help in creating strong perpendicular joints. They are useful in furniture making and structural support where two beams need a firm connection.
  • Flat Brackets
    • Flat brackets are used to reinforce joints without changing the shape of the structure. They work well for furniture, cabinets, and wooden frames.
  • Adjustable Brackets
    • Adjustable brackets allow flexibility in positioning the post, making them ideal for DIY projects and temporary constructions.

Each type serves a unique purpose, ensuring a secure and durable setup for 4×4 posts.

How to Make a Metal Bracket for a 4×4

  • Materials Required:
    • Steel or aluminum sheet (¼ inch thick)
    • Measuring tape
    • Marker or scribe
    • Metal cutting saw (or angle grinder with a cutting disc)
    • Drill machine with metal bits
    • Clamps
    • Welding machine (if needed)
    • Sandpaper or file
    • Rust-proof paint or coating
  • Step 1: Measuring and Marking
    • Start by measuring the dimensions of the bracket. For a 4×4 post, the inner space should be 3.5 x 3.5 inches (since a standard 4×4 post is actually 3.5 inches thick). Use a measuring tape and marker to outline the cutting areas on the metal sheet.
  • Step 2: Cutting the Metal
    • Use a metal cutting saw or an angle grinder to cut the metal sheet according to the marked lines. Ensure straight and precise cuts to fit the post properly.
  • Step 3: Drilling Holes
    • Drill holes in the metal bracket for screws or bolts. Usually, two to four holes on each side are enough for a strong hold. Use a metal drill bit slightly larger than the bolt size for a perfect fit.
  • Step 4: Bending (If Required)
    • If the design requires bent edges, use a metal brake or clamps with a hammer to bend the sheet at the desired angles. This helps in providing extra strength and a better grip on the post.
  • Step 5: Welding (If Needed)
    • For a welded bracket, join metal pieces together using a welding machine. Ensure proper welding for durability and grind the welded areas for a smooth finish.
  • Step 6: Smoothing and Finishing
    • Use sandpaper or a metal file to remove sharp edges and rough surfaces. This prevents injuries and improves the overall appearance of the bracket.
  • Step 7: Coating for Rust Protection
    • Apply rust-resistant paint or powder coating to protect the metal from moisture and corrosion. Let it dry completely before installation.

This method ensures a strong, durable, and weather-resistant metal bracket for 4×4 posts.

Materials Used for Metal Bracket for 4×4 Post

When choosing a metal bracket for a 4×4 post, the material plays a key role in strength, durability, and weather resistance. Here are some commonly used materials:

  • Stainless Steel
    • Corrosion-resistant, making it ideal for outdoor use.
    • Strong and long-lasting, suitable for heavy loads.
    • Requires minimal maintenance over time.
  • Galvanized Steel
    • Coated with zinc to prevent rust and corrosion.
    • Perfect for humid or rainy environments.
    • More affordable than stainless steel but still highly durable.
  • Aluminum
    • Lightweight yet strong, making it easy to install.
    • Naturally resistant to rust without any coating.
    • Best for decorative or lightweight applications.
  • Powder-Coated Steel
    • A layer of protective coating enhances durability.
    • Available in different colors for a stylish finish.
    • Prevents rust and wear over time.

Each material has its advantages, so selecting the right one depends on the environment, load capacity, and durability needs.

Advantages and Disadvantages of Metal Bracket for 4×4 Post

Pros of Metal Bracket for 4×4 Post
  • High Durability: Metal brackets provide strong support and last longer than wooden or plastic alternatives.
  • Weather Resistance: They can withstand rain, sun, and harsh outdoor conditions without rusting (if made of stainless steel or galvanized metal).
  • Strong Load-Bearing Capacity: These brackets offer excellent strength to hold heavy loads securely.
  • Easy Installation: Most metal brackets come with pre-drilled holes, making installation quick and simple.
  • Versatility: Available in different designs and sizes, suitable for various construction needs.
Cons Metal Bracket for 4×4 Post
  • Costly Compared to Wood: Metal brackets are generally more expensive than wooden alternatives.
  • Prone to Rust: If not galvanized or coated, some metals may corrode over time.
  • Weight Issues: Heavier metal brackets may require additional support during installation.
  • Limited Flexibility: Unlike wood, metal cannot be easily adjusted or reshaped once installed.

FAQs About Metal Bracket for 4×4 Post

What is a metal bracket for a 4×4 post?
  • A metal bracket for a 4×4 post is a sturdy support used to secure wooden posts in fences, decks, pergolas, and other structures. It provides stability and prevents movement or damage over time.
What materials are used for metal brackets?
  • Most metal brackets are made from galvanized steel, stainless steel, or powder-coated iron, ensuring strength, durability, and resistance to rust and corrosion.
How do I install a metal bracket for a 4×4 post?
  • Position the bracket at the base or side of the post.
  • Secure it using screws, bolts, or concrete anchors, depending on the surface.
  • Ensure proper alignment for maximum stability.
Are metal brackets weather-resistant?
  • Yes, galvanized and stainless steel brackets are designed to resist rain, snow, and UV exposure, making them ideal for outdoor use
What types of metal brackets are available for 4×4 posts?
  • Corner brackets: Reinforce corners for added strength.
  • Post base brackets: Anchor posts to concrete or wood surfaces.
  • Adjustable brackets: Allow flexibility in positioning.
Can I use metal brackets for DIY projects?
  • Yes, metal brackets are beginner-friendly and commonly used in DIY fencing, deck construction, and garden structures.

Do I need special tools to install a metal bracket?
  • Basic tools like a drill, screwdriver, wrench, and level are enough for most installations.
